Hail fellow Sworn! I have a question about companions.

Can they use the moves or are they limited to merely assisting. Couldn’t find a good answer in the rule book.

    NPCs (including companions) don't make their own moves. Everything is funneled through the character, and companions can provide assistance via their abilities.

    However, companions are not automatons, and you should also weave them into your narrative and they may give you narrative framing that helps you in a situation. For example, if you faced a foe who was mounted or could run faster than you, fleeing may not make any sense. If you have a horse companion, you can Face Danger to get the heck out of there. Depending on your upgrades, your companion's ability might also come into play when you make that move.
